Tree planting services involve professional contractors helping property owners add new trees to their landscapes. This process includes selecting appropriate tree species based on the property’s soil, climate, and space, as well as preparing the planting site to ensure healthy growth. The work often involves digging large holes, planting young trees carefully, and providing initial support to help them establish roots. These services aim to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property, increase shade, or contribute to environmental efforts by introducing more greenery into the area.

The overview below groups typical Tree Planting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Tree Planting Jobs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for planting a few trees in residential yards.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ering basic planting and minor site prep. Larger or more complex projects tend to exceed this band.
Medium-Scale Planting Projects - Projects involving multiple trees or larger landscapes us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These are common for homeowners looking to enhance their property with several new trees. Fewer projects reach into higher price tiers.
Large Property Planting - For extensive planting on large estates or commercial sites, costs generally range from $2,000 to $5,000. Such projects often include site preparation, multiple species, and specialized planting techniques. Larger, more complex jobs can surpass this range.
Full Tree Replacement Services - Replacing mature or large trees can cost from $1,000 to over $5,000 depending on size, species, and site conditions. Many contractors handle these as specialized projects, with costs increasing for more substantial or difficult-to-access trees.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
